1What is the typical cost for professional carpet cleaning in Horton, and what factors influence the price?

In the Horton area, the average cost ranges from $0.25 to $0.50 per square foot, with most whole-home services falling between $150-$400. Key factors include the carpet's soil level (influenced by local red clay soils and farm dust), the presence of pet stains, and the specific cleaning method required. Always request an in-home or detailed virtual estimate from local providers for the most accurate pricing.

2When is the best time of year to get carpets cleaned in Horton, Kansas?

Late spring (May) and early fall (September/October) are ideal. These periods avoid the high humidity of a Kansas summer, which can slow drying times, and the freezing temperatures of winter, which can complicate water usage and technician travel. Scheduling outside of peak farming seasons may also provide more flexible appointment availability with local companies.

3Are there any local Horton or Kansas regulations I should be aware of regarding carpet cleaning wastewater disposal?

Yes, it's crucial to hire a professional who follows Kansas Department of Health and Environment (KDHE) guidelines. Wastewater from cleaning, especially if it contains chemicals or heavy soil, should never be dumped into a storm drain, ditch, or your septic system. Reputable Horton-area cleaners will have a proper plan for containing and disposing of wastewater in accordance with local sewer or approved waste disposal regulations.

5How long will it take for my carpets to dry after a cleaning, and how can I speed it up in our Kansas climate?

With professional hot water extraction, carpets typically take 6-12 hours to dry completely in Horton's variable climate. To speed drying, open windows during low-humidity periods, run your home's HVAC system to circulate air, and use ceiling fans. Avoid scheduling cleaning on extremely humid or rainy days, as the moist air from the Missouri River valley can significantly extend drying times.
